What changes in Beijing

National starting pointBeijing implementationVerify with
China applies pre-establishment national treatment plus the foreign-investment negative list.Beijing's Foreign Investment Regulation adopts that framework across the municipality and identifies local investment-service and management responsibilities.Current national negative list and Beijing competent authority
Restricted sectors must satisfy listed conditions and prohibited sectors are unavailable to foreign investment.Beijing registration guidance distinguishes sectors outside the list, restricted sectors whose conditions are met, and prohibited sectors that cannot be registered.Beijing registration authority and sector regulator
National security review is a separate national transaction screen.A Beijing project may also require approval or filing with the competent development and reform authority or a designated area administration; that local procedure does not replace national security review.Transaction screens and competent Beijing project authority

Beijing questions

How does Beijing apply the foreign-investment negative list at registration?

Beijing's official FAQ says investments outside the negative list receive domestic-equivalent registration treatment. For a restricted sector, registration may proceed when the stated conditions are satisfied; if the competent sector regulator has already granted the legally required operating permission, the registration authority does not re-examine those conditions. Investment in a prohibited sector cannot be registered. Always use the currently effective national or applicable FTZ list, not an archived edition.

Source: People's Government of Beijing Municipality — foreign-investment negative-list FAQ · Updated 23 Aug 2026

Can a Beijing foreign-investment project require a separate local approval or filing?

Yes. Beijing's 2024 Foreign Investment Regulation says a project requiring approval or filing must apply under national and Beijing rules to the competent development and reform authority or, where applicable, the Beijing Economic-Technological Development Area, Beijing Municipal Administrative Center or Beijing Daxing International Airport Economic Zone administration. Company registration alone does not complete that project procedure or any national security review.

Source: Beijing Investment Promotion Service Center — Beijing Foreign Investment Regulation · Updated 23 Aug 2026

Local institutions

Beijing Municipal Commission of Development and Reform

Role: Competent authority for Beijing foreign-investment project administration within its assigned scope.

Use when: Confirming whether a project requires Beijing approval or filing and which authority has jurisdiction.

Official site →

Beijing Investment Promotion Service Center

Role: Publishes Beijing foreign-investment rules, registration and investor-service guidance.

Use when: Checking Beijing-facing investment procedures and locating the competent local service channel.

02 · Local overview

City-flavored guidance for foreign clients — how fdi and national security plays out in Beijing.

Foreign investment in Beijing starts with national market-access and security-review rules, then adds Beijing registration, project approval or filing and sector-specific administration. A transaction should be screened before signing because market access, national security review, merger control, data and licensing can run in parallel.

Market access and registration

Beijing applies pre-establishment national treatment plus the foreign-investment negative list. Investments outside listed restrictions generally receive domestic-equivalent registration treatment, while restricted sectors must satisfy the stated conditions and prohibited sectors cannot be registered.

Project and sector procedures

A Beijing investment may also require project approval or filing with the competent development and reform authority, or prior sector permission. Company registration does not replace those separate gates.

Security-review planning

National security review is a national process. Beijing location can affect the factual file, project authority and sector contacts, but it does not create a separate municipal substitute for the national review mechanism.

03 · FAQ

Common questions about Beijing fdi and national security

Quick answers for foreign nationals and companies. Rules vary by forum and change over time.

Does a Beijing company registration clear all FDI issues?

No. Registration does not replace negative-list compliance, project approval or filing, sector licensing, merger control, data review or national security review where applicable.

Who handles a Beijing foreign-investment project filing?

The competent authority depends on the project and location. Beijing rules identify development and reform authorities and specified area administrations as possible competent filing or approval bodies.

Should national security review be assessed before signing?

Yes. Screen sector sensitivity, control, assets, technology, data, supply chains and transaction structure early enough to allocate conditions, timing and filing risk in the deal documents.
